I hate that they put that list like that: "Private jets full of gold. Missile-guidance systems. Unbreakable encryption. African militias. Explosives. Kidnapping." One of the things in this list is not like the other.

Unbreakable encryption For all practical purposes, it is true.

Unbreakable encryption is a thing though. It's called one-time-pad and it doesn't require any sort of fancy algorithms. As long as your random key is the same length as the message, the decryption is literally unbreakable(because the contents could decode into literally any other message of the same length).

As basically a complete novice in encryption, it was interesting to learn about the unbreakable "one-time pad" method.

"The one-time pad (OTP) is an encryption technique that cannot be cracked, but requires the use of a one-time pre-shared key the same size as, or longer than, the message being sent. In this technique, a plaintext is paired with a random secret key (also referred to as a one-time pad). Then, each bit or character of the plaintext is encrypted by combining it with the corresponding bit or character from the pad using modular addition."

For those who are interested in TrueCrypt history, here (it is in Russian) https://news.softodrom.ru/ap/b19702.shtml (https://translate.google.com/translate?sl=auto&tl=en&u=https...) author did a small research and came to conclusion that TrueCrypt most likely was created by a Czech guy named David Tesařík.

Update: IMHO this research is the most comprehensive one which I saw regarding TrueCrypt authorship
